Output 3c5efd0d760c06977a6e19a51051c28ecde3bf005537c98bc756ec29232b20ce:7

value
1609300
script pubkey
OP_0 OP_PUSHBYTES_20 36c4d6bda89873254e835ededbf5410f08445940
address
bc1qxmzdd0dgnpej2n5rtm0dha2ppuyygk2qu36kx7
transaction
3c5efd0d760c06977a6e19a51051c28ecde3bf005537c98bc756ec29232b20ce
confirmations
25654
spent
true